I have a in-wall media cabinet that allows me to run cat5 cables to multiple rooms.  I've managed to get internet connection working by connecting the ONT box to the my personal router (Ubiquity EdgeRouter X). 

As I understand it from reading the posts, I need to keep using the G1100 in order to keep my STB working with guides, on demand, DVR, etc... 

So, the current setup I'd like to achieve is the following:

ONT Box -> EdgeRouter X -> G1100

ONT Box connected to the WAN port of the EdgeRouter X.  The G1100's WAN port is connected to a LAN port on the EdgeRouter X.

I'd still like to use the G1100 to provide internet to the other devices either through the LAN ports or Wifi.  The problem I am running into is that devices connected to the G1100 cannot access the internet.  What am I missing?

Ok. Seems like your G1100 has multiple configuration problems.

1. Edge LAN and G1100 LAN are not on the same network segment.

This is due to you connected Edge <LAN--WAN> G1100. You need to change the ethernet cable to Edge <LAN--LAN> G1100. LAN ports on G1100 are now switched with the uplink Edge port.

You would better disable the Broadband function on G1100. Go to the Web Configuration Interface, My Networks -> Network Connections -> Broadband Connection (Ethernet/Coax) -> Disable.image

2. G1100's underlying devices cannot access the Internet.

This is due to your G1100's DHCP server is not disabled. G1100 still hands out IP addresses and DNS address (it's own IP address). To disable the DHCP server, go to Advanced -> IP Address Distribution -> Network (Home/Office) -> IP Address Distribution: Disabled.

Here are some questions for you. Do you want all of your devices on the same network segment? You have the WAN of G1100 uplinked to a LAN of Edge Router. This will create a quasi-firewall between the LAN of the Edge and the LAN of the G1100.

Are the IP addresses of the Edge and G1100 the same? Can your devices on G1100 access the Edge’s LAN? Is the DNS not working or the routing itself?

The STB uses MoCA LAN, so as long as the G1100 is on, it should work. You might need to find the existing port forwarding rules for the STB on G1100, and duplicate them on the Edge, so Verizon’s upstream can talk to the STB.
